I have a similar problem. Using the garch-function from the package t-series,
there is sometimes the warning "false convergence" in the output. In other
cases, this warning is not given and instead there is the message "relative
function convergence". The problem is that this happens with the same
parameters of the time series(simulated with the same parameters). Sometimes
this message disappears, if the function receives different start values
from the user. 

My question is: Should I still use this function or is this a real problem?
Is this message about false convergence something to worry about?
